Facilities Engineer, Portfolio Optimization (3 openings)Location: On-site at Luke Air Force Base, Glendale, ArizonaType: Full-time, direct hire with VLinc CorporationAnticipated start: Late September 2026Status: Contingent upon contract award About the workLuke AFB is home to the Air Force's largest F-35 pilot training wing, and the 56th Civil Engineer Squadron plans, programs, and sustains the facilities that keep that mission running. VLinc is hiring three engineers to embed full-time with the squadron's Portfolio Optimization element. This is the front end of the facility lifecycle: deciding what gets built and repaired, making the case for the money, and setting projects up so they execute well. Your work products go straight to squadron and wing leadership.What you'll do• Prepare and refine project programming documents (DD Form 1391 and AF Form 813 packages) that justify and compete facility requirements for funding• Develop parametric and detailed construction cost estimates using PACES and RSMeans• Plan and facilitate planning charrettes with squadron personnel and mission partners• Support installation planning products, including Installation Development Plan (IDP) and Comprehensive Planning Program (CPP) deliverables• Tailor Unified Facilities Guide Specifications (UFGS) for squadron projects• Share in the team's Title II construction management workload (roughly a quarter of the aggregate effort): site inspections, quality assurance surveillance, and construction documentationWhat you'll need• Bachelor's degree in civil, mechanical, electrical, or architectural engineering, or a closely related field• Experience programming, estimating, or planning facility projects, ideally on a military installation• Working knowledge of construction cost estimating tools such as PACES, RSMeans, or comparable• Clear, persuasive technical writing; programming packages succeed or fail on the narrative• Ability to obtain and maintain installation access, including a favorable background checkNice to have• Prior support to an Air Force civil engineer squadron or equivalent installation engineering organization• Hands-on DD 1391 development in PACES and charrette facilitation experience• PE or EIT registration• Familiarity with UFC criteria and the Air Force installation planning frameworkWhy VLincVLinc is a service-disabled veteran-owned small business headquartered in Chandler, about 25 miles from the Luke AFB gate. You get local corporate leadership that knows facilities work, direct access to company decision-makers, and a role where your judgment shapes the installation's built environment for years.
